Solution for x-13=-3x+31 equation:


Simplifying
x + -13 = -3x + 31

Reorder the terms:
-13 + x = -3x + 31

Reorder the terms:
-13 + x = 31 + -3x

Solving
-13 + x = 31 + -3x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'3x' to each side of the equation.
-13 + x + 3x = 31 + -3x + 3x

Combine like terms: x + 3x = 4x
-13 + 4x = 31 + -3x + 3x

Combine like terms: -3x + 3x = 0
-13 + 4x = 31 + 0
-13 + 4x = 31

Add '13' to each side of the equation.
-13 + 13 + 4x = 31 + 13

Combine like terms: -13 + 13 = 0
0 + 4x = 31 + 13
4x = 31 + 13

Combine like terms: 31 + 13 = 44
4x = 44

Divide each side by '4'.
x = 11

Simplifying
x = 11
